
That is thanks to the game's Friend Pass. The best part about It Takes Two is that only one player needs to purchase the game to get the full experience. Unfortunately, this version of It Takes Two does not have cross-platform play, meaning those on different devices can't play with someone on the Nintendo Switch. Both players will also need to create or sign in to their EA account. In both scenarios involving two Nintendo Switch devices, all a person has to do is send an invitation for a player to join them in a game. If the two players are on different Wi-Fi networks, they must each get the game on their device and then connect through Online Co-Op. If the two players are on the same Wi-Fi network and each have a Switch, each player can download the game on their devices and connect through Local Wireless Play. From here, individuals can pick their character and begin. After purchasing and booting up the game, simply connect two controllers, one for each player.

If two people are in the same room, they can play the game on the same device through Couch Co-Op.
